The Senior Drilling Engineer is responsible to oversee, manage, and consult on well design, and programs. Keep senior management informed of project progress and proposed additional projects. 

Requirements

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: 

  • Manage drilling engineering consultants and eventually internal drilling engineers
  • Design wells, drilling programs and interventions to maximize safety of employees and assets
  • Work closely with 
  • team of geoscientists, reservoir engineers, drilling personnel, power plant personnel and management to ensure define and execute activities
  • Build program to grow Drilling Engineering Department with focus on drilling design and oversight
  • Prepare and execute work programs to deliver company goals in safe and efficient manner
  • Design programs appropriate for environmental and regulatory constraints
  • Supervise and manage coil tubing and rig cleanouts and workovers
  • Track program costs, control expenditures, and communicate to all stakeholders, including final reports with lessons learned and changes for future implementation
  • Identify new technology or developments to improve safety, operational efficiency, and economic outcomes
  • Lead design reviews, pre-activity program review, and post-activity reviews with stakeholders and vendors
  • Assist with root cause analysis for failures and safety incidents
  • Develop business cases and evaluate project economics
  • Develop authorization for expenditures and key decision reports for projects
